I have 2 diferent books that are telling me that the fuel pressure on my '85 turbo is suposto be 61-71psi. And I have a fuel pressure gauge that I just put on that is telling me I have about 25psi @ idle, 30psi @ cruse, and maxes out at 44psi@WOT.

What gives???? If I'm intended to have 61-71psi I wouldn't think that the engine would even run @ 25psi:eek: Are the books wrong, or am I WAY low on fuel pressure?

to re state what calebz said: 70 psi is before the FPR, 35 after, I'm running ~50psi (probably too rich) in my aftermarket RRFPR,

 

I had simmilar issues as those you reported in an earlier thread, so I swapped my fuel filter, and ran lucas injector cleaner recently, when I drain my tank a couple more times I'll throw on another filter, I definitly had some rust issues, the car sat since 1998, but the problem didn't present itself until after rally-xing, weeling and running out of gas in the same day, 3 months after building the car...

 

I might pull the fuel line going into the fuel filter(or earlier), hotwire the pump and totally drain the tank a couple of time just to see what kind of chunks fly out, just be sure not to run the pump too dry.
